| Abstract: | Mn-substituted apatites have a broad application prospects in medicine as bone substitutes. Properties of such material largely depend on the state of manganese in the apatite structure. In this work, the mechanochemical method in a planetary ball mill is shown to be used for synthesis of Mn-substituted hydroxyapatite containing Mn2+ cations in the position of Ca2+. The maximum degree of isomorphic substitution for this synthesis method is x = 0.7. The resulting material possesses low thermal stability compared to unsubstituted hydroxyapatite due to the small ionic radius of the substituent. The decomposition temperature depends on the degree of substitution and occurs in the temperature range of 700–800 °C with the release of Mn 3 O 4 and β-phase of Ca 3–х Mn x (РО 4) 2.
